|| Загрузка файлов на сервер |
Все файлы, кроме рисунков, загружайте на сервер в ASCII режиме (у FTP- клиентов есть соответствующая опция). Пример размещения продемонстрирован на рисунке. Помните, что Unix системы (а сервер у вас наверняка под этой ОС) чувствительны к регистру букв, поэтому если не хотите запутаться, для названия файлов и папок используйте маленькие буквы. Папка templates содержит один или несколько шаблонов - закиньте ее как есть. Вы можете закачать и свой шаблон (необязательно создавать его через веб-интерфейс, дома, в оффлайне, с данным руководством наперевес процесс создания шаблона более комфортабельный)
В общем, загружаем.. Не забудьте создать папку с рисунками и загрузить туда эмотикончики (хотя их можно закачать после установки системы через веб - заодно проверите загрузчик файлов) и рисунки-кнопки, для QuickHTML.
| |
|| Права доступа (chmod) |
Смотрим на рисунок, смотрим рекомендации своего хостера - находим компромисс.
Если хостер у вас не бесплатный, то наверняка никаких мытарств с правами доступа у вас нет, если вы смутно представляете что это такое, то советуем действовать по принципу: всем директориям, содержащим скрипты ставим права 755 (для некоторых 750, а вообще, желательно делать как советует хостинг-провайдер), всем *.cgi файлам 755, библиотечкам, файлам с данными (т.е. cfg.cfg, Sanitarium_WL.pm, Comments_WL.pm) ставим 666 или 660.
На картинке это и изображено.
Бесплатные хостеры, часто предлагают использовать несколько иные права как для исполняемых скриптов, файлов с данными, так и для директорий их содержащих - поэтому посмотрите рекомендации своего хостера.
Публичные директории, файлы имеют права 777
| |
|| Запуск setup.cgi |
После того, как вы все загрузили, расставили права доступа, запускайте свой верный броузер, набирайте URL файла setup.cgi (например, http://webscript.ru/cgi-bin/sanitarium/admin/setup.cgi )
Запустится скрипт, который посмотрит - все ли там, где вы указали в cfg.cfg, создаст некоторые директории, если вы их ранее не создали (например для рисунков), проверит ваш сервер на наличие необходимых модулей (File_DB.pm), создаст несколько Баз Данных (база для авторов, база для категорий, индексная база - они должны появиться в папке /data - файлы с расширением *.dat).
После того, как скрипт напишет, что он все сделал - можете смело его удалять. Его даже нужно удалить - так что не ленитесь.
Вы почти уже все сделали, осталось немного!
| |
|